| Surname | Bayne | |||
| First Name(s) | John | |||
| Place of Birth | Dunblane, Perthshire | |||
| Club(s) | Brentford Heart of Midlothian Raith Rovers | |||
| Service | British Army | |||
| Rank | Private | |||
| Service Number | 3/3694 | |||
| Previous Service Number(s) | - | |||
| Regiment or Corps | Royal Highlanders (Black Watch) | |||
| Unit(s) | 2nd Battalion | |||
| Previous Regiment(s) or Corps | - | |||
| Unit(s) | - | |||
| Type of Casualty (If applicable) | Killed in Action | |||
| Theatre of War (If applicable) | Western European Theatre | |||
| Date of Death (If applicable) | 21/07/1915 | |||
| Place of Death (If applicable) | France and Flanders | |||
| Place of Burial/Commemoration (If applicable) | St. Vaast Post Military Cemetery, Richebourg-L’avoue | |||
| Grave/Memorial Reference (If applicable) | I. J. 2. | |||
| Awards and Decorations | - | |||
| Citation(s) | - | |||
